The ZWO AM3n represents the newest generation of harmonic drive mounts. It's incredibly portable, lightweight, and easy to transport, making it an excellent choice for astrophotographers who frequently travel to dark skies. The trade-off is cost. The AM3n is a good bit more expensive, and you'll need to purchase several pieces separately to build a complete setup. The Sky-Watcher HEQ5 Pro takes a different approach. It's heavier and much less portable, but that extra weight provides excellent stability. It also comes as a complete package with everything needed to start imaging, making it one of the best values in astrophotography.
